Commit c81931d0 authored by Yuan Zhixiang's avatar Yuan Zhixiang
Browse files

修改超时逻辑

parent e5bf73d1
...@@ -44,7 +44,11 @@ def visualize(): ...@@ -44,7 +44,11 @@ def visualize():
elif len(result) == 0: elif len(result) == 0:
return {'error': '分析失败。'} return {'error': '分析失败。'}
elif result == 'timeout': elif result == 'timeout':
return {'error': '程序过大,分析超时。'} error_message = {'error': '该程序占用过大,请优化后再试。'}
if redis_available:
r.set(key, json.dumps(error_message))
r.expire(key, 3600)
return error_message
else: else:
if redis_available: if redis_available:
r.set(key, result) r.set(key, result)
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ment